โหมดดูใน Drupal 8 . คืออะไร
เผยแพร่แล้ว: 2022-02-16Drupal เป็นที่รู้จักกันดีในเรื่องความยืดหยุ่นในการจัดการและนำเสนอเนื้อหา โหมดมุมมอง Drupal อนุญาตให้คุณแสดง (แสดง) เอนทิตีหรือเอนทิตีของ Drupal (เช่น โหนด) ด้วยวิธีใดวิธีหนึ่ง ตามบริบทเฉพาะ
บทช่วยสอนนี้จะสาธิตการใช้งานโหมดมุมมอง Drupal พร้อมตัวอย่าง เราจะติดตั้งและใช้โมดูล Field Group และ Display Suite
มาเริ่มกันเลย!
ขั้นตอนที่ 1. ติดตั้งโมดูลที่จำเป็น
เปิด แอปพลิเคชั่นเทอร์มินัลแล้ววางเคอร์เซอร์ไว้ที่รูทของการติดตั้ง Drupal
- พิมพ์:
นักแต่งเพลงต้องการ “drupal//field_group:^3.0"
นักแต่งเพลงต้องการ drupal/ds
คลิก ขยาย
เปิดใช้งาน Display Suite และ Field Group
คลิก ติดตั้ง
ระบบจะแจ้งให้คุณเปิดใช้งานโมดูล Layout Discovery
- คลิก ดำเนินการ ต่อ
ไม่จำเป็นต้องใช้โมดูลเพิ่มเติม
ขั้นตอนที่ 2. ประเภทเนื้อหา
สำหรับจุดประสงค์ของบทช่วยสอนนี้ เราจะสร้างประเภทเนื้อหาที่เรียกว่า 'บุคคลที่มีชื่อเสียง' โดยมีรายละเอียดฟิลด์ในตารางด้านล่าง ตามด้วยประเภทเนื้อหาเดียวกันหรือสร้างประเภทอื่น เช่น 'ผู้เขียน' 'ผู้ป่วย' หรือแม้แต่เอนทิตีประเภทอื่น เช่น 'สมาชิก' - จำไว้ว่า โหมดมุมมองสามารถใช้ได้กับเอนทิตีทุกประเภท ไม่ใช่แค่โหนด
ชื่อสนาม | ประเภทฟิลด์ | จำนวนค่าที่อนุญาต | ข้อมูลเพิ่มเติม |
ภาพ | ภาพ | 1 | |
เกิด | วันที่ | 1 | วันที่เท่านั้น - กลุ่มฟิลด์ ข้อมูลส่วนตัว |
เสียชีวิต | วันที่ | 1ซั่ว | วันที่เท่านั้น - กลุ่มฟิลด์ ข้อมูลส่วนตัว |
เป็นที่รู้จักสำหรับ | ข้อความ (จัดรูปแบบยาว) | 1 | กลุ่มภาคสนาม ข้อมูลส่วนตัว |
ชีวิตในวัยเด็ก | ข้อความ (จัดรูปแบบยาว) | 1 | |
งานชีวิต | ข้อความ (จัดรูปแบบยาว) | 1 | |
ความตาย | ข้อความ (จัดรูปแบบยาว) | 1 | |
เรื่องไม่สำคัญ | ข้อความ (จัดรูปแบบยาว) | 1 | รายการหัวข้อย่อย |
ดาวน์โหลดไฟล์ | ไฟล์ | ไม่ จำกัด | ไฟล์เพิ่มเติมที่จะดาวน์โหลด / นามสกุลไฟล์ที่อนุญาต: txt, pdf, doc, xls, xlsx, docx, jpg, png |
ลิงก์ที่เกี่ยวข้อง | ลิงค์ | ไม่ จำกัด | ลิงค์ไปยังแหล่งข้อมูลอื่น |
ทุ่งนา:
เกิด
เสียชีวิต
เป็นที่รู้จักสำหรับ
จะถูกจัดกลุ่มในกลุ่มฟิลด์ที่เรียกว่าข้อมูลส่วนบุคคล
ขั้นตอนที่ #3 สร้างกลุ่มฟิลด์
- คลิก จัดการการแสดงผล > เพิ่มกลุ่มฟิลด์
- เลือก Fieldset ในเมนูดร็อปดาวน์
- เพิ่ม ป้ายกำกับที่เหมาะสม
- คลิก สร้างกลุ่ม
ลาก fieldset ใต้ฟิลด์ Image
ซ่อน ป้ายกำกับรูปภาพ
จัดกลุ่ม ฟิลด์ภายใน fieldset โดยเยื้อง
สร้าง ป้ายกำกับภายใน fieldset inline
คลิก บันทึก
โปรดสังเกต ว่า เรากำลังกำหนดค่าโหมดมุมมองแอ็กทีฟหนึ่งในสองโหมดใน Drupal ( ค่าเริ่มต้น และ ทีเซอร์ ) แล้ว
โหมดมุมมองเริ่มต้นจะแสดงทั้งโหนด ในขณะที่โหมดมุมมองทีเซอร์จะแสดงการแสดงทีเซอร์ของบทความบนหน้าแรกของ Drupal
ขั้นตอนที่ #4 สร้างเนื้อหา
คลิก เนื้อหา > เพิ่มเนื้อหา > บุคคลที่มีชื่อเสียง
สร้าง 4 ถึง 5 โหนด
ขั้นตอนที่ #5 สร้างโหมดมุมมองที่กำหนดเอง
คลิก โครงสร้าง > ประเภทเนื้อหา
เลือก จัดการการแสดงผล สำหรับประเภทเนื้อหา 'บุคคลที่มีชื่อเสียง'
เลื่อน ลงและ คลิก การตั้งค่าการแสดงผลแบบกำหนดเอง
คลิก จัดการโหมดการดู
ที่นี่ เราสามารถกำหนดค่าโหมดมุมมองที่มีอยู่สำหรับเอนทิตีประเภทต่างๆ ( บันเดิ ล ) นอกจากนี้เรายังสามารถสร้างโหมดการดูแบบกำหนดเองเพื่อให้ตรงกับความต้องการด้านการออกแบบหรือข้อมูลของเรา
คลิก เพิ่มโหมดการดู
คลิก เนื้อหา
ตั้งชื่อที่ถูกต้อง ให้ โหมดมุมมอง
คลิก บันทึก
สร้าง โหมดการดูอีก 2 โหมด
ฉันใช้ชื่อเหล่านี้: โหมด มุมมองชีวิต - โหมดมุมมอง เรื่อง ไม่สำคัญ
คลิก โครงสร้าง > ประเภทเนื้อหา
เลือก บุคคลที่มีชื่อเสียง > จัดการการแสดงผล
เลื่อน ลงและ คลิก การตั้งค่าการแสดงผลแบบกำหนดเอง อีกครั้ง
ตรวจสอบ โหมดการดู 3 โหมดที่คุณเพิ่งสร้างขึ้น
คลิก บันทึก
คลิก โหมดมุมมอง ข้อมูลส่วนบุคคล
เลื่อน ลงและ เลือก เค้าโครงสองคอลัมน์ (ภายใต้ตัวเลือก Display Suite) จากดรอปดาวน์
คลิก บันทึก
คลิก บันทึก อีกครั้ง (ในที่สุด) เพื่อย้ายเขตข้อมูลไปยังคอลัมน์ใหม่
ลาก ชุดฟิลด์ ข้อมูลส่วนบุคคล ไปที่ด้านบนของคอลัมน์ด้านซ้าย
วาง สามฟิลด์ที่เกี่ยวข้องตามลำดับ
วาง รูปภาพบนคอลัมน์ด้านขวา
เปลี่ยน รูปแบบรูปภาพ เป็นสื่อ
คลิก อัปเดต
ลาก ฟิลด์อื่นทั้งหมดไปยังส่วน ปิด การใช้งาน
เลื่อน ลงแล้ว คลิก บันทึก
ทำซ้ำ ขั้นตอนกับอีกสองโหมดมุมมองโดยใช้ตัวเลือกเค้าโครง:
ความกว้างเท่ากับสามคอลัมน์
สามคอลัมน์ 25/50/25
ขั้นตอนที่ #6 สร้างมุมมอง
คลิก โครงสร้าง > มุมมอง > เพิ่มมุมมอง
ตั้งชื่อที่ถูกต้อง ให้ มุมมอง
เลือก เนื้อหา ประเภท บุคคลที่มีชื่อเสียง
ตรวจสอบ สร้างบล็อก
เปลี่ยน จำนวน รายการต่อบล็อก เป็น 1
ทำ เครื่องหมาย ใช้เพจเจอร์
คลิก บันทึกและแก้ไข
คลิก ตัวเลือก ฟิลด์ ภายใต้ส่วน รูปแบบ
เลือก เนื้อหา
คลิก สมัคร
เลือก โหมดดูภาพแรก
คลิก สมัคร
คลิก บันทึก
คลิก ส่วน ขั้นสูง ทางด้านขวาของ Views UI
คลิก ที่ ใช้ AJAX: ไม่ใช่
ตรวจสอบ ใช้ AJAX
คลิก สมัคร
คลิก บันทึก
สร้าง อีก 2 บล็อกด้วยกระบวนการเดียวกัน การตั้งค่าเดียวที่จะแตกต่างออกไปคือโหมดดูในส่วน รูปแบบ
ขั้นตอนที่ #7 วางบล็อค
สร้าง บทความที่มีเพียงชื่อเรื่อง
คลิก บันทึก
คลิก โครงสร้าง > เค้าโครงบล็อก
เลื่อน ลงไปที่ส่วน เนื้อหา
คลิก วางบล็อก
ค้นหา ทั้ง 3 บล็อก
คลิก วางบล็อก
ยกเลิกการเลือก แสดงชื่อ
จำกัด การบล็อกไว้ที่บทความที่เราเพิ่งสร้างขึ้น
คลิก บันทึกบล็อก
ทำซ้ำ ขั้นตอนกับอีก 2 ช่วงตึก
จัดเรียง บล็อกใหม่ใต้ชื่อ
คลิก บันทึกบล็อก
ตรงไปที่บทความและดู
Drupal เท่! ยินดีด้วย!
โปรดบอกเราว่าคุณวางแผนที่จะใช้คุณสมบัติ Drupal ที่มีประโยชน์นี้อย่างไร ขอบคุณที่อ่าน!